PUBLIC LIBRARY SERVICES | ELKADER PUBLIC LIBRARY

Items that may be borrowed from or used in the library include books, music recordings, videos and DVDs, audiobooks; magazines, and newspapers. The library also has computers and WiFi for public access. There are also library-sponsored programs for all ages offered.
